How does Caixa Seguridade monetize bancassurance across Brazil?
Caixa Seguridade leverages Caixa Econômica Federal’s nationwide customer base to distribute mass-market protection products, converting scale into fee income and profit sharing through asset-light joint ventures and partnerships.
As the listed holding (B3: CXSE3), it manages JVs across insurance, pensions, capitalization bonds, consortiums and brokerage, earning commissions, fees and dividends while benefiting from high distribution productivity and strong cash generation.

What Are the Key Operations Driving Caixa Seguridade’s Success?
Caixa Seguridade opera um modelo bancassurance asset-light, combinando fábricas de produtos em joint ventures, corretagem centralizada e a extensa rede da Caixa (mais de 4.000 agências e 13.000 lotéricas) para alcançar massas e clientes de renda média, beneficiários do INSS, mutuários habitacionais, PMEs e servidores públicos.
Operação via joint ventures para vida, crédito, residencial, previdência e odontologia; parceiros especializados assumem underwriting e reinsurance, ampliando capacidade técnica e gerindo risco.
Produtos são ofertados nos momentos-chave bancários — abertura de conta, portabilidade de salário, originação de crédito e financiamento habitacional — aumentando conversão e reduzindo CAC.
Corretora centraliza comércio, otimiza take rates e comissionamento, e uniformiza governança de vendas para melhor eficiência comercial.
Plataformas comuns para compliance, gestão de sinistros, atendimento e TI reduzem custo unitário e garantem conformidade regulatória.
O modelo de negócios Caixa Seguridade entrega valor por meio de escala na franquia hipotecária, persistência via vínculos sociais e de folha, dados proprietários de clientes e parcerias de re/seguro que ampliam a oferta de produtos e otimizam capital.
A combinação de alcance e parceiros gera taxas de conversão elevadas, churn reduzido e melhores unit economics versus agências independentes, permitindo seguros simples e acessíveis para populações subatendidas.
- Alcance físico: mais de 4.000 agências e 13.000 lotéricas;
- Segmentos-chave: massa, renda média, INSS, mutuários Caixa, PMEs e servidores;
- Mecanismos: distribuição embutida, scoring digital, ofertas pré-aprovadas e CRM para cross-sell;
- Parcerias: capacidade de subscrição e reinsurance fornecida por seguradoras/pension managers líderes.

How Does Caixa Seguridade Make Money?
Revenue Streams and Monetization Strategies for Caixa Seguridade center on bancassurance commissions, performance-linked joint‑venture income, pension management fees, capitalization/consortium charges, and ancillary digital and service fees, with a mix increasingly weighted to high‑persistency life and pension products and strong attachment to Caixa credit flows.
Brokerage fees from policies sold through Caixa channels (life, credit life, mortgage/homeowners, dental, others) form the largest recurring revenue source, linked to written premiums and portfolio persistency.
Variable remuneration from joint ventures and reinsurance arrangements when combined ratios and financial results exceed agreed thresholds, aligning incentives with underwriting profitability.
Management fees tied to AUM and front loads on PGBL/VGBL plans distributed via Caixa; pension AUM growth—Brazil surpassed R$1.4 trillion in 2024—boosts annuity‑like, recurring revenue.
Issuance and administration fees for savings‑lottery capitalization bonds and vehicle/real‑estate consortium administration deliver high margins despite smaller absolute volumes.
Cross‑sell, app‑based add‑ons, assistance products and service fees bundled with banking journeys enhance ARPU and conversion via digital channels and analytics.
Monetization leverages embedded offers, bundled protection with credit, tiered pricing by risk, campaign‑driven cross‑sell and app push notifications to Caixa’s mass retail base.
The company’s revenue mix skews to protection (credit life, mortgage/homeowners) and pensions; capitalization and consortiums remain smaller but high‑margin lines. Strong mortgage origination and payroll credit flows in 2023–2024 sustained attachment rates for credit‑linked covers, supporting stable commission income and higher persistency in individual life and pensions while maintaining volume in credit‑linked covers. Principal mechanisms that drive monetization and scalability across products and channels.
- Commissions tied to written premiums and portfolio persistency; recurring nature amplifies lifetime value.
- Profit‑sharing boosts variable income when underwriting results outperform benchmarks.
- Management fees scale with pension AUM; front loads provide upfront cash inflows.
- High attachment rates to credit products—supported by robust mortgage and payroll credit volumes in 2023–2024—raise ARPU and reduce distribution CAC.

Which Strategic Decisions Have Shaped Caixa Seguridade’s Business Model?
Key milestones show Caixa Seguridade's evolution from a bancassurance JV to a listed, capital-light distributor with strong dividend policy, digital-first distribution, and scale advantages that sustain profits across cycles.
Consolidation of distribution rights and joint ventures created a clear corporate boundary and enabled an IPO that prioritized payouts; the structure supports high ROE via asset-light operations and steady cash dividends.
Deep integration into Caixa’s core banking systems and mobile app increased digital issuance, lowering customer acquisition cost and raising issuance speed and pre-approved offer conversion.
Re-tendering partner contracts improved commission economics and profit-sharing alignment; expanded reinsurance programs and stricter underwriting boosted earnings stability through rate cycles.
Launches in dental, assistance bundles and simplified life/pension products increased attach rates and ticket sizes, diversifying revenue beyond credit-related covers.
Resilience through macro cycles derives from Caixa’s mortgage leadership and payroll-deductible base, which maintained steady policy flows and persistency despite interest-rate volatility.
Competitive advantages combine exclusive distribution touchpoints, privileged customer data for pre-approved offers, scale to negotiate favorable insurer terms, and an asset-light model that drives cash return to shareholders.
- Unmatched physical and digital reach via Caixa branches and app, enabling broad origination and cross-sell.
- Exclusive rights at credit touchpoints (mortgages, payroll loans) produce steady policy flow and high persistency.
- Privileged data enables targeted pre-approved offers, improving conversion and lowering CAC.
- Scale and asset-light structure support cash dividends and defensive margins against private banks and fintechs.

How Is Caixa Seguridade Positioning Itself for Continued Success?
Caixa Seguridade ocupa posição de destaque no mercado de bancassurance brasileiro, com liderança em crédito-décimo e habitacional e forte presença em vida individual e previdência via canais massivos; a retenção apoia‑se em vínculos de crédito e folha e crescente engajamento digital no app da Caixa.
Caixa Seguridade é uma das maiores plataformas de bancassurance do Brasil, beneficiando‑se da liderança da Caixa em financiamento habitacional e folha de pagamento; em 2024 manteve participação superior em seguro habitacional e crédito vida.
O modelo de distribuição integra agências, aplicativo e correspondentes, com tendência a aumentar vendas digitais e straight‑through processing para elevar attachment rates nos produtos e serviços Caixa Seguridade.
Alterações normativas sobre amarração de produtos bancários e regras de distribuição bancassurance representam risco direto ao modelo de negócios Caixa Seguridade.
Pressão competitiva de seguradoras de bancos privados e players digitais, sensibilidade a ciclos de crédito e habitação e riscos de conduta em ampla rede de distribuição podem afetar receita e margem.
Gestão prioriza digitalização, aumento de vendas de vida e previdência individuais e otimização da joint venture para preservar payout e geração de caixa; o gap de proteção no Brasil e a expansão da previdência privada indicam espaço para crescimento.
Foco em analytics para cross‑sell, elevação de persistência e eficiência operacional com meta de manter alto índice de conversão e payout sustentado pela forte conversão de caixa.
- Ampliação de vendas digitais e straight‑through processing.
- Expansão de vida individual e previdência para melhorar persistência.
- Proteção do relacionamento hipotecário e de folha para manter attachment.
- Defesa de margem via controle de custos e otimização da JV econômica.
